Gather what you already know about your family. Scour your basement, attic and closets (and those of your family members) and collect family records, old photos, letters, diaries, photocopies from family Bibles, even newspaper clippings. 2. Talk to your relatives. Ask your parents, grandparents, aunts and uncles about their memories.

WebJun 19, 2024 · Plan the Research – Ask a question about the individual or family you will research. Formulate a goal based on the question and create a plan to meet that goal. The goal should be specific and achievable and the plan should be precise yet flexible. WebFeb 24, 2024 · Before you jump online, sit down with a pen and paper and write down what you know. Fill in as much as you can. For each person, you’re looking for names, dates, and locations. The absolute minimum you want for each person on your tree is their full name and when and where they were born, married, and if applicable, died.

WebAug 6, 2024 · Step Two: Ask Your Relatives. While you're collecting family records, set aside some time to interview your relatives. Start with Mom and Dad and then move on from there. Try to collect stories, not just names and dates, and be sure to ask open-ended questions. Try these questions to get you started.
